    Sears was the first store to open, doing so in August 1972. [4] One month later, Kroger and 20 other mall shops had opened as well. [3] Official opening ceremonies occurred on September 13, 1972, and were initiated by a ribbon-cutting ceremony hosted by Indianapolis' then-mayor Richard Lugar.     The Wholesale District is one of seven designated cultural districts in Indianapolis, Indiana, United States.Located in the south-central quadrant of downtown Indianapolis' Mile Square, [2] the district contains the greatest concentration of 19th-century commercial buildings in the city, including Indianapolis Union Station and the Majestic Building.
